Image default
Máy Tính

Lập Trình Cơ Bản: Bí Quyết Tự Động Hóa & Nâng Cao Hiệu Suất Máy Tính

Bạn có thể chưa biết một bí mật này: bạn không cần có kỹ năng lập trình nâng cao để viết những đoạn mã cơ bản, và việc học cách làm điều đó có thể tạo ra sự khác biệt lớn trong cách bạn sử dụng máy tính. Bất kỳ ai cũng có thể thực hiện, ngay cả khi bạn không có kinh nghiệm lập trình từ trước. Học cách viết các script cơ bản bằng một ngôn ngữ như Python hoặc Bash có thể giúp bạn tiết kiệm rất nhiều thời gian cho mọi việc, từ tổ chức các tệp tin cho đến chỉnh sửa tài liệu văn bản, và nhiều tác vụ khác. Hãy cùng tìm hiểu lợi ích của lập trình cơ bản trong việc tự động hóa công việc và tối ưu hiệu suất máy tính của bạn.

1. Tự Động Hóa Công Việc Lặp Lại: Nói Lời Tạm Biệt Với Sự Tẻ Nhạt

Giải phóng thời gian khỏi những công việc thủ công

Có những tác vụ mà một số người dùng lặp đi lặp lại gần như hàng ngày, chúng cần thiết nhưng lại tốn rất nhiều thời gian. Sao lưu dữ liệu là một ví dụ điển hình. Bạn hoàn toàn có thể viết một script cơ bản để thực hiện việc sao lưu này thay cho bạn. Một ví dụ khác, giả sử bạn đang theo dõi lượng hàng tồn kho của một sản phẩm (có thể là Nintendo Switch 2?). Bạn có thể viết một script sẽ tự động kiểm tra trang web và thông báo cho bạn nếu có bất kỳ thay đổi nào. Thật tiện lợi phải không?

Chúng ta hãy đi xa hơn một chút. Nếu bạn là một nhiếp ảnh gia thường xuyên tải lên một lượng lớn ảnh mỗi ngày, bạn có thể viết một script tự động đổi tên các tệp dựa trên ngày chúng được tải lên, thậm chí có thể gắn thẻ cho các bức ảnh để bạn có thể tìm thấy chúng dễ dàng hơn sau này.

Tự động hóa quản lý máy chủ với AnsibleTự động hóa quản lý máy chủ với Ansible

2. Nâng Cao Hiểu Biết Về Hệ Thống Máy Tính Của Bạn

Khắc phục sự cố dễ dàng hơn

Bạn có thể không cần kỹ năng lập trình nâng cao để viết script, nhưng khi bạn học cách sử dụng các ngôn ngữ lập trình tốt hơn, bạn sẽ hiểu rõ hơn về những gì đang diễn ra bên trong máy tính. Bạn sẽ cần cấp quyền phù hợp để script hoạt động nếu bạn muốn nó sắp xếp dữ liệu cho mình, và khi làm như vậy, bạn cũng sẽ tìm hiểu về cấu trúc tệp và các lớp khác nhau trong ổ đĩa máy tính. Các tác vụ khác có thể yêu cầu bạn giám sát việc sử dụng tài nguyên hệ thống, chẳng hạn như mức độ đòi hỏi CPU của một ứng dụng cụ thể.

Giao diện Parallels Desktop trên ChromeOS hiển thị mã lỗiGiao diện Parallels Desktop trên ChromeOS hiển thị mã lỗi

Khi bạn tìm hiểu tất cả các yếu tố khác nhau tạo nên hệ điều hành của mình, bạn sẽ tự nhiên có được sự hiểu biết tốt hơn về những gì đang diễn ra, và khi các vấn đề phát sinh, thông báo lỗi của chúng sẽ trở nên có ý nghĩa hơn rất nhiều đối với bạn. Bạn sẽ nhận ra các nhật ký và có thể xác định nơi và khi nào có điều gì đó không ổn. Bạn cũng sẽ có thể nhận ra nếu một chương trình đang hoạt động thất thường và sử dụng nhiều tài nguyên hơn mức cần thiết.

3. Cải Thiện An Ninh Mạng & Bảo Mật Cá Nhân

Giảm thiểu rủi ro từ lỗi người dùng

Nếu bạn thường xuyên xem TV, bạn có thể nghĩ rằng các hacker dựa vào hàng loạt kiến thức mã hóa và sự tinh xảo về kỹ thuật để đột nhập vào máy tính của bạn. Hầu hết thời gian, sự thật nhàm chán hơn nhiều: họ chỉ khai thác các điểm yếu trong hệ thống của bạn, như các lỗ hổng bảo mật chưa được vá. Bạn có thể cải thiện bảo mật máy tính của mình bằng cách viết một script tự động kiểm tra và tải xuống các bản cập nhật bất cứ khi nào chúng có sẵn. Bằng cách loại bỏ yếu tố con người — trí nhớ của chính bạn — khỏi phương trình, bạn khiến mạng gia đình của mình khó bị đột nhập hơn rất nhiều.

Cài đặt Windows Update trên Windows 11Cài đặt Windows Update trên Windows 11

Và theo cùng một logic, bạn có thể viết script để xử lý các tác vụ bảo trì hệ thống. Dọn dẹp ổ đĩa không còn là mối lo lớn trong thời đại ổ cứng thể rắn hiện đại, nhưng nếu bạn có một NAS (thiết bị lưu trữ mạng) hoặc cách lưu trữ tệp tương tự, bạn có thể viết script để giám sát các lỗi đọc/ghi và thông báo cho bạn nếu bất kỳ ổ đĩa nào của bạn bắt đầu có dấu hiệu hư hỏng.

Tiện ích mở rộng NordVPN trên Firefox hiển thị màn hình đăng nhậpTiện ích mở rộng NordVPN trên Firefox hiển thị màn hình đăng nhập

4. Tạo Lối Tắt & Tối Ưu Quy Trình Làm Việc Cá Nhân

Tăng tốc quy trình chỉ với một cú nhấp chuột

Mỗi ngày, chúng ta thực hiện rất nhiều tác vụ thường xuyên mà bạn có thể không nhận ra chúng tốn bao nhiêu thời gian. Chắc chắn, có thể chỉ mất vài giây để mở trình duyệt, nền tảng email của bạn, v.v., nhưng tất cả thời gian đó cộng lại sẽ rất đáng kể. Bạn có thể viết một script Python cho phép bạn mở tất cả các ứng dụng cần thiết chỉ với một cú nhấp chuột; ví dụ, nó có thể mở Thunderbird, trình duyệt của bạn (và các tab cụ thể), và thậm chí chia màn hình desktop của bạn thành nhiều cửa sổ. Các phím tắt như thế này có thể giúp bạn tiết kiệm một lượng lớn thời gian và về cơ bản là phiên bản script của Tony Stark búng tay.

Bạn cũng có thể viết các phím tắt để điền văn bản. Nếu bạn phải viết các email có định dạng gần như giống nhau nhiều lần trong ngày, các phím tắt mở rộng văn bản có thể giúp bạn tiết kiệm rất nhiều thời gian (và có thể cả hội chứng ống cổ tay nữa). Các công dụng tiềm năng khác bao gồm tự động điền các biểu mẫu đầu vào trên các trang web và nhiều hơn nữa.

Học các kỹ năng lập trình cơ bản là rất đáng giá, ngay cả khi bạn không nghĩ rằng mình sẽ sử dụng chúng thường xuyên. Bạn có thể tùy chỉnh máy tính của mình tốt hơn để phù hợp với nhu cầu riêng của mình, và ai biết được — bạn có thể khám phá ra niềm đam mê với mã hóa mà bạn chưa từng biết mình có. Rốt cuộc, viết mã là một hình thức sáng tạo tự thân, và việc tìm ra cách làm cho một cái gì đó hoạt động theo ý muốn của bạn giống như giải một câu đố vậy. Hãy bắt đầu hành trình tự động hóa công việc và khám phá tiềm năng của máy tính cùng congnghetonghop.com ngay hôm nay!

Related posts

Immich: Giải Pháp Tự Lưu Trữ Ảnh Cá Nhân Vượt Trội Hơn Google Photos và iCloud

Administrator

Thử Nghiệm Home Assistant Cho Danh Sách Mua Sắm Gia Đình: Từ Hy Vọng Đến Nỗi Hối Tiếc

Administrator

AnyDesk: Lựa Chọn Thay Thế TeamViewer Tối Ưu Cho Mọi Nền Tảng Và Ngân Sách?

Administrator